Touring cycling around Orenhofen offers diverse landscapes within the Eifel region of Rhineland-Palatinate, Germany. The area features varied topography, including rolling hills, dense forests, and the meandering Kyll Valley. Cyclists can expect routes with both paved surfaces and segments that might be unpaved, providing a mix of terrain. The region's elevation gains contribute to varied cycling experiences.

The region around Orenhofen offers diverse landscapes, characterized by rolling hills, dense forests, and the picturesque Kyll Valley. You'll find a mix of paved surfaces and some unpaved segments, providing varied terrain for touring cyclists. The area also features significant elevation gains, contributing to a dynamic cycling experience.
Yes, Orenhofen offers several options for easier rides. Out of the 14 touring cycling routes available, 3 are classified as easy. These routes are perfect for those looking for a more relaxed pace or less challenging terrain.
The region boasts breathtaking natural features. The Kyll Valley is a highlight, with the river meandering through a gorge, offering views of waterfalls and lush valleys. You can also find routes leading to observation towers, such as the Zemmer Rodt Observation Tower, which provides panoramic vistas of the Eifel landscape. Consider the route Zemmer Rodt Observation Tower – Zemmer-Rodt Observation Tower loop from Orenhofen for views of this tower.
Absolutely. The area is rich in history. You can discover ancient castles and Roman remains. Notable historical sites include the Roman copper mine and quarry Pützlöcher, known for its intriguing rock formations. The town of Orenhofen itself features historic architecture from the 17th century.
Yes, many of the touring cycling routes around Orenhofen are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end in the same location. For example, the Schönfelder Hof Pond – Lourdes Grotto Beilingen loop from Orenhofen and the Pottery Trader Statue Speicher – Preister Weiher loop from Orenhofen are popular circular options.
The touring cycling routes in Orenhofen are highly regarded by the komoot community, with an average rating of 4.6 stars from over 1700 reviews. Cyclists often praise the varied terrain, scenic beauty, and the well-maintained paths that make for an enjoyable experience.
Yes, the region features interesting caves that can be integrated into your cycling tours. You can explore the Genoveva Cave, which also serves as a shelter, or the secluded and beautiful Klausen Cave (Hermit's Cave). The Roman copper mine and quarry Pützlöcher also offers intriguing rock formations.
Routes vary in length and duration. For instance, the Schönfelder Hof Pond – Preister Weiher loop from Orenhofen is about 18.3 km and takes around 1 hour 28 minutes. Longer routes like Burgknopp – To the picture loop from Orenhofen cover approximately 28.8 km and can take over 2 hours to complete, depending on your pace.
Yes, the area offers several huts and shelters. You might come across places like the Angler’s Lodge Waldsee-Bad Schandau on the Kyll, the Rondehütte, or the Grill Shelter with Fire Pit (Eifel Forest). The Genoveva Cave can also provide shelter in rainy weather.
The Eifel region around Orenhofen is particularly beautiful in spring when nature is in full bloom, and in autumn with its vibrant colors. These seasons generally offer pleasant temperatures for cycling, making them ideal for exploring the diverse landscapes.
The hilly landscape means you should expect varied terrain and some routes with significant elevation gains. While there are easy options, many routes are moderate. Some segments might be unpaved, so a touring bicycle suitable for mixed surfaces is recommended.
